Webb3 juli 2024 · Detect errors while performing Redis commands. A typical use-case is to use Redis as a cache. Your application will attempt to fetch a cached key from Redis. If it exists, it is used. Otherwise, a request is made to fetch the data from the underlying primary source database and then the data is written to a Redis cache.
